一种基于VPDN的嵌入式网络开票税务云终端设计方法技术

技术编号:7244878 阅读:1324 留言:0更新日期:2012-04-11 18:40
本发明专利技术提供一种基于VPDN的嵌入式网络开票税务云终端设计方法,是针对网络开票行业领域内的发明专利技术,网络开票终端通过VPDN和网络开票后台实时进行数据交互,有效的保证数据传输过程中票据信息的安全性和实时性,在终端上实现在线开票。该发明专利技术要解决的技术问题是在ARM平台+uclinux的基础上实现支持l2tpvpn的客户端设备,实现VPDN的接入和数据的安全传输。通过移植l2tp协议和ppp协议到uclinux系统之中,并开发应用程序,实现VPDN账户和密码的可配置,VPDN网络的手动连接和断开,给用户开放友好的人机交互界面。

【技术实现步骤摘要】

本专利技术涉及一种金融税控
,适用于网络开票行业,具体地说是一种基于 VPDN的嵌入式网络开票税务云终端的设计方法。
技术介绍
随着网络开票的不断兴起,对于数据在网络中传输的安全性越来越高。这就要求比较分散的网络开票终端用户具备一种完备的安全机制,能和部署在内网中的后台进行数据交互。VPDN技术特别适合于地点分散,对线路的保密和可用性有一定要求的用户。本文中基于VPDN的网络开票终端,是集打印接口、显示接口、键盘接口、网络接口、USB接口、串口于一体的开票机具,具有快捷输入、人机界面交互友好、简单易操作、专机专用、成本低、 可扩展性强等众多优点。
技术实现思路
本专利技术的目的是提供一种基于VPDN的嵌入式网络开票税务云终端的设计方法。本专利技术的目的是按以下方式实现的,在当前运营商部署的VPDN及通讯设备基础上,设计专用的支持VPDN的开票终端,实现发票数据的实时打印、采集。设计内容包括开票终端硬件设计、驱动设计、模具设计、软件设计四部分内容。硬件设计主要包括原理图设计和PCB设计,驱动设计主要包括打印驱动设计、显示驱动设计、USB驱动设计和网络驱动设计。软件设计主要包括文件系统设计、PPP协议实现、12tp vpn客户端实现和应用程序开发。设计步骤如下1)12tp和PPP协议移植,根据网络开票终端采用的平台进行协议移植,并植入配置文件来实现客户端的VPDN的接入功能,从而建立起安全的网络开票通道;2)宽带单机拨号用户单独设置VPDN账号和密码,通过pppoe拨号接入VPDN服务器; 局域网或者非单机用户接入VPDN服务器;具备3G无线上网卡的用户,通过网络开票终端的 USB接口驱动3G上网卡,来接入VPDN服务器;网络开票终端都通过VPDN实现和开票后台的实时的安全的数据交互;3)采用隧道技术,将数据封装在隧道中进行传输,有效的屏蔽开票数据在internet上传输的不安全性实现专网专用;4)网络开票终端硬件开发设计网络开票终端主板,包括原理图、PCB设计制作; 模具设计5)软件设计硬件接口驱动开发将硬件驱动编译为开票终端内核可以识别的模块在uclinux系统中实现Ppp拨号在uclinux中实现vpn客户端的功能在uclinux中实现vpdn的功能应用程序设计,通过VPDN实现发票的开具和数据上传功能。本专利技术的有益效果是可以解决网络开票终端开票数据传输的安全性,具备不同网络环境的用户有了更大的网络接入灵活性。附图说明图1嵌入式网络开票税务云终端体系图2基于VPDN的嵌入式开票税务云终端网络系统结构图。具体实施例方式参照说明书附图对本专利技术的方法作以下详细地说明。本专利技术的主要技术要点包括12tp协议和ppp协议在ucl inux上的实现方法、12tp vpn客户端的配置方法、ppp拨号的配置方法、数据安全传输的方法。本专利技术的主要用途是让具备连接internet的局域网内的网络开票终端可实现VPDN的接入。在当前运营商部署的VPDN及通讯设备基础上,设计专用的支持VPDN的开票终端, 实现发票数据的实时打印、采集。设计内容包括开票终端硬件设计、驱动设计、模具设计、软件设计四部分内容。硬件设计主要包括原理图设计和PCB设计,驱动设计主要包括打印驱动设计、显示驱动设计、USB驱动设计和网络驱动设计。软件设计主要包括文件系统设计、 PPP协议实现、12tp vpn客户端实现和应用程序开发。设计步骤如下1)12tp和ppp协议移植,根据网络开票终端采用的平台进行协议移植,并植入配置文件来实现客户端的VPDN的接入功能,从而建立起安全的网络开票通道;2)宽带单机拨号用户单独设置VPDN账号和密码,通过pppoe拨号接入VPDN服务器; 局域网或者非单机用户接入VPDN服务器;具备3G无线上网卡的用户,通过网络开票终端的 USB接口驱动3G上网卡,来接入VPDN服务器;网络开票终端都通过VPDN实现和开票后台的实时的安全的数据交互;3)采用隧道技术,将数据封装在隧道中进行传输,有效的屏蔽开票数据在internet上传输的不安全性实现专网专用;4)网络开票终端硬件开发设计网络开票终端主板,包括原理图、PCB设计制作; 模具设计5)软件设计硬件接口驱动开发将硬件驱动编译为开票终端内核可以识别的模块在uclinux系统中实现Ppp拨号在uclinux中实现vpn客户端的功能在uclinux中实现vpdn的功能应用程序设计,可以通过VPDN实现发票的开具,数据上传等功能除说明书所述的技术特征外,均为本专业技术人员的已知技术。权利要求1. 一种基于VPDN的嵌入式网络开票税务云终端设计方法,其特征在于在当前运营商部署的VPDN及通讯设备基础上,设计专用的支持VPDN的开票终端,实现发票数据的实时打印、采集,设计内容包括开票终端硬件设计、驱动设计、模具设计、软件设计四部分,硬件设计包括原理图设计和PCB设计,驱动设计包括打印驱动设计、显示驱动设计、USB驱动设计和网络驱动设计,软件设计包括文件系统设计、PPP协议实现、12tp vpn客户端实现和应用程序开发;设计步骤如下1)12tp和ppp协议移植,根据网络开票终端采用的平台进行协议移植,并植入配置文件来实现客户端的VPDN的接入功能,从而建立起安全的网络开票通道;2)宽带单机拨号用户单独设置VPDN账号和密码,通过pppoe拨号接入VPDN服务器; 局域网或者非单机用户接入VPDN服务器;具备3G无线上网卡的用户,通过网络开票终端的 USB接口驱动3G上网卡,来接入VPDN服务器;网络开票终端都通过VPDN实现和开票后台的实时的安全的数据交互;3)采用隧道技术,将数据封装在隧道中进行传输,有效的屏蔽开票数据在internet上传输的不安全性实现专网专用;4)网络开票终端硬件开发设计网络开票终端主板,包括原理图、PCB设计制作;模具设计5)软件设计硬件接口驱动开发将硬件驱动编译为开票终端内核可以识别的模块在uclinux系统中实现Ppp拨号在uclinux中实现vpn客户端的功能在uclinux中实现vpdn的功能应用程序设计,通过VPDN实现发票的开具和数据上传功能。全文摘要本专利技术提供一种基于VPDN的嵌入式网络开票税务云终端设计方法,是针对网络开票行业领域内的专利技术,网络开票终端通过VPDN和网络开票后台实时进行数据交互,有效的保证数据传输过程中票据信息的安全性和实时性,在终端上实现在线开票。该专利技术要解决的技术问题是在ARM平台+uclinux的基础上实现支持l2tpvpn的客户端设备,实现VPDN的接入和数据的安全传输。通过移植l2tp协议和ppp协议到uclinux系统之中,并开发应用程序,实现VPDN账户和密码的可配置,VPDN网络的手动连接和断开,给用户开放友好的人机交互界面。文档编号G07F17/42GK102404394SQ20111035418公开日2012年4月4日 申请日期2011年11月10日 优先权日2011年11月10日专利技术者刘来波, 赵兰兴, 黄正茂 申请人:浪潮齐鲁软件产业有限公司本文档来自技高网...

【技术保护点】

【技术特征摘要】

【专利技术属性】
技术研发人员:赵兰兴黄正茂刘来波
申请(专利权)人:浪潮齐鲁软件产业有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1
相关领域技术